What does CBD stand for?

Chances are you’ve heard about CBD, it’s currently at the forefront of the wellness movement, and CBD products sales are booming. You can literally find CBD in almost anything these days, CBD Tea, CBD Coffee, CBD vape oil, CBD Water, and even a CBD infused mattress has recently hit the market. CBD is a compound extracted from hemp or cannabis plants. Take note that CBD is THC-free and entirely non-psychoactive, meaning you won’t feel any mind-altering effects from using it.
